Abstract: The differences between the three common fatigue strength analysis methods for bogie frame are studied. Comparison of the three main methods, the normative loading spectrum from the railway standard, the loading spectrum from multiple rigid body system dynamics simulation(MRBSDS) and the stress spectrum from running test, is conducted on one trailer bogie frame under the same precondition. During the analysis, the quasi-static superposition method is used to convert the loading spectrum to stress spectrum. Among the quasi-static superposition method, stress response factor(SRF) is defined, which is useful for the conversion between loading spectrum and stress spectrum. Equivalent stress of one million kilometers is used to contrast the three methods. Though comparative analysis, fatigue analysis results based on the railway standard are conservative and results from the MRBSDS method could not predict the fatigue life accurately. From the frequency domain comparative analysis, MRBSDS method should adopt the real line spectrum which contains high-frequency components and consider rigid-flexible coupled model to create loading spectrum.
